(In reply to Simon Geard from comment #1) > How much disk space is required by a kernel update? I ask because I only > have a small boot partition (30MB). There weren't any errors when I did the > update but maybe it fails silently if it runs out of disk space and doesn't > complete the install, is that possible? That is the issue. 30MB is not nearly large enough anymore, unfortunately. Even 50MB isn't always in some cases. It's a pain how quickly the size of the kernels and initrds have blown up in the last few years, leaving those of us with small boot partitions unable to use them anymore. On some systems my partitions were ordered in such a way that I was able to expand it, but on my laptop I had to abandon the use of the boot partition and just move the boot directory to my root partition, which works just fine in my case. But yes, it will fail to create the initrd if there's not enough space. This isn't really a bug, just a bummer. You'll have to adjust your /boot storage somehow. Status:
